    I'll tell you my main concern. I'm concerned about what opposing D coordinators are going to learn from this game. I'm concerned that they are going to learn that MF does not react well to pressure. I'm concerned that when you pressure MF he doesn't know where to go with the ball. I'm concerned that MF's ball security when pressured is questionable. There were times in the game when he was going down that he held the ball out away from his body. A couple of times he just tried to fling it away while he was falling. If I was Florida's D coordinator I would blitz as soon as I got to Hammond.
